We're looking for an experienced Compliance Manager to play a pivotal role within our Risk & Conduct function. This isn't a "tick-box" compliance position. It's an opportunity to genuinely influence strategy, shape governance, champion Consumer Duty and help create an environment where doing the right thing for customers is simply how business is done.
You'll work closely with senior leaders across the organisation, acting as a trusted advisor on regulatory matters, driving continuous improvement and helping embed a culture of accountability, compliance and customer-first thinking. You'll take ownership of key elements of our compliance framework, ensuring we're not only meeting regulatory expectations but continuously strengthening our approach.
- Leading compliance monitoring activity and regulatory returns
- Providing senior-level advice and challenge to business stakeholders
- Monitoring FCA and regulatory developments and translating them into practical action
- Delivering insightful compliance reporting, identifying trends, risks and opportunities
- Owning policy governance and ensuring accountability across the business
- Acting as a key subject matter expert on Consumer Duty, conduct risk and governance
- Reviewing and approving financial promotions and customer communications
- Leading GDPR and data protection activities, including DPIAs, SARs and privacy governance
- Designing and delivering engaging compliance training and awareness initiatives
- Helping senior leaders understand the operational impact of regulatory change
